A snapshot of the U.S. economy for the last six months.
Document Highlights
- The rate of core inflation increased to 1.8 per cent in April.
- The economy generated 248,000 new jobs and the unemployment rate remained unchanged at 5.6 per cent.
- Consumer confidence was 93.2 in May, a slight increase from the reading of 93.0 in April.
